Italian Drunken Noodles Recipe
This Italian drunken noodle recipe is a delicious twist on a classic dish that has become a family favorite. With rich flavors and hearty ingredients, it’s no wonder we often find ourselves making a double batch. Perfect for weeknight dinners or special occasions, this dish combines pasta with a savory sauce and a variety of vegetables. Here’s how to make it!
Ingredients
For the Noodles:
- 12 oz. wide egg noodles (or pappardelle)
- Salt (for pasta water)
For the Sauce:
- 1 lb. ground beef (or Italian sausage)
- 1 medium onion, diced
- 2 cloves garlic, minced
- 1 bell pepper (red, yellow, or green), diced
- 1 medium carrot, diced
- 1 can (14 oz.) diced tomatoes (with juices)
- 2 cups chicken or vegetable broth
- 1/2 cup red wine (optional, for the “drunken” aspect)
- 1 tsp dried oregano
- 1 tsp dried basil
- 1/2 tsp red pepper flakes (adjust to taste)
- Salt and pepper to taste
- Fresh parsley, chopped (for garnish)
- Grated Parmesan cheese (for serving)
